diff options
author | 2015-06-08 11:48:28 +0000 | |
---|---|---|
committer | 2015-06-08 12:54:27 +0000 | |
commit | e18142dfb46f539dd14eece322ad2a60437eede6 (patch) | |
tree | b45952914f929101921fc7b8f5709cc4da0aafb2 /src/main/java/com/google/devtools/build/lib | |
parent | a068dee102a27e1a4f14fca7be96714b3b477bba (diff) |
Do not add LocalGccStrategy and LocalLinkStrategy to ActionContextProviders in BazelRulesModule, as they are already added in the StandaloneContextProvider.
--
MOS_MIGRATED_REVID=95428810
Diffstat (limited to 'src/main/java/com/google/devtools/build/lib')
-rw-r--r-- | src/main/java/com/google/devtools/build/lib/bazel/rules/BazelRulesModule.java | 11 |
1 files changed, 0 insertions, 11 deletions
diff --git a/src/main/java/com/google/devtools/build/lib/bazel/rules/BazelRulesModule.java b/src/main/java/com/google/devtools/build/lib/bazel/rules/BazelRulesModule.java index 4656c2c66a..b1c6ae28ea 100644 --- a/src/main/java/com/google/devtools/build/lib/bazel/rules/BazelRulesModule.java +++ b/src/main/java/com/google/devtools/build/lib/bazel/rules/BazelRulesModule.java @@ -19,15 +19,11 @@ import com.google.common.collect.ImmutableList; import com.google.common.collect.ImmutableMap; import com.google.common.eventbus.Subscribe; import com.google.devtools.build.lib.actions.ActionContextConsumer; -import com.google.devtools.build.lib.actions.ActionContextProvider; import com.google.devtools.build.lib.actions.Executor.ActionContext; -import com.google.devtools.build.lib.actions.SimpleActionContextProvider; import com.google.devtools.build.lib.analysis.ConfiguredRuleClassProvider; import com.google.devtools.build.lib.query2.output.OutputFormatter; import com.google.devtools.build.lib.rules.cpp.CppCompileActionContext; import com.google.devtools.build.lib.rules.cpp.CppLinkActionContext; -import com.google.devtools.build.lib.rules.cpp.LocalGccStrategy; -import com.google.devtools.build.lib.rules.cpp.LocalLinkStrategy; import com.google.devtools.build.lib.rules.genquery.GenQuery; import com.google.devtools.build.lib.runtime.BlazeModule; import com.google.devtools.build.lib.runtime.BlazeRuntime; @@ -140,13 +136,6 @@ public class BazelRulesModule extends BlazeModule { optionsProvider.getOptions(BazelExecutionOptions.class))); } - @Override - public Iterable<ActionContextProvider> getActionContextProviders() { - return SimpleActionContextProvider.of( - new LocalGccStrategy(optionsProvider), - new LocalLinkStrategy()); - } - @Subscribe public void gotOptions(GotOptionsEvent event) { optionsProvider = event.getOptions(); |